Handing off the Quillbus broker upgrade (4.x to 5.1) to Dario. Cluster is half-migrated; mixed-version mode is supported but TLS cert rotation must finish before cutover. No auth model changes, though the admin API gained two new endpoints worth reviewing. Open questions and the migration checklist are tracked on the internal page below.

dashboard of taduf-bawef = https://jira.lumicsys.internal/projects/display/browse/b1cbf89d

Ticket: Expired credential on Wrengate health-check probe

The synthetic health-check probe behind the Wrenmouth load balancer started failing auth yesterday, marking healthy nodes as down and triggering needless drains. Root cause: the probe's internal credential expired. This change swaps in a rotated key and adds an expiry alert. Reviewer note: the new key for the probe service is below.

app token of hahig-fawip = vxb4-lyC2

Hey — handing FeedCheck over before I rotate to the Brindle team. It validates podcast RSS for the Wavelet platform: enclosure sizes, episode GUIDs, artwork dimensions, the usual. The cron runs hourly; failures land in the triage queue. Watch out for feeds with duplicate GUIDs — the dedupe logic is fragile and I left a TODO there. Tests are solid otherwise. Everything else, including the quirks list and deploy steps, is written up on the internal page.

wiki page, yagef-fahaf: https://grafana.ferracorp.corp/spaces/view/projects/board/job/board/issue/dddcb27874b55298d2204852

**Ticket BRM-442: Stale-branch cleanup bot deletes protected release branches**

Repro steps:
1. Deploy Sweepling v2.3 against the Quarrel repo.
2. Tag a branch `release/9.x` with no commits for 31 days.
3. Run the nightly sweep job.
4. Observe the protected branch is force-deleted despite the exclusion rule.

For the security review, the bot authenticates using the following credential.

login token, bagug-kafop: eyJhbGciOiJIUzI1NiIsInR5cCI6IkpXVCJ9.eyJzdWIiOiIcMLov2In0.Z5RLDIfp